Edwin Cheng
|
fcb1eef323
|
Change TokenSource to iteration based
|
2019-05-25 20:41:03 +08:00 |
|
Edwin Cheng
|
1ea0238e53
|
Add classify_literal and undo expose next_token
|
2019-04-05 18:45:19 +08:00 |
|
Edwin Cheng
|
1ab78d6056
|
Fix literal support in token tree to ast item list
|
2019-04-05 18:23:01 +08:00 |
|
Aleksey Kladov
|
0c1cb98182
|
rename
|
2019-02-23 16:07:29 +03:00 |
|
Aleksey Kladov
|
412ac63ff5
|
docs
|
2019-02-21 15:24:42 +03:00 |
|
Aleksey Kladov
|
c47f9e2d37
|
fix compilation
|
2019-02-21 13:37:32 +03:00 |
|
Aleksey Kladov
|
79ce0fa8d7
|
move whitespace handling to tree builder
|
2019-02-21 12:03:42 +03:00 |
|
Aleksey Kladov
|
882c47f187
|
move syntax error to parser
|
2019-02-20 23:17:07 +03:00 |
|
Aleksey Kladov
|
61992dc1cd
|
simplify
|
2019-02-20 23:05:59 +03:00 |
|
Aleksey Kladov
|
4c1f9b8d4e
|
remove TokenPos
|
2019-02-20 23:02:24 +03:00 |
|
Aleksey Kladov
|
cce23fddba
|
flattern module structure
|
2019-02-20 22:52:32 +03:00 |
|
Aleksey Kladov
|
2b5e336ce7
|
move abstract traits to top
|
2019-02-20 22:19:12 +03:00 |
|
Aleksey Kladov
|
45fc91cc47
|
rearrange modules in a suggestd reading order
|
2019-02-20 16:24:39 +03:00 |
|
Aleksey Kladov
|
a4a1e08ab8
|
flatten modules
|
2019-02-20 16:16:14 +03:00 |
|
Aleksey Kladov
|
5222b8aba3
|
move all parsing related bits to a separate module
|
2019-02-20 15:47:32 +03:00 |
|